LALS 056. Brazilian Society in Film


(Cross-listed with FMST 056)
This course proposes to explore issues of race, sex, gender, and class in contemporary Brazilian film. Film, for the purpose of the class, will be viewed as text and analyzed for articulations of national discourses on the four topic areas mentioned above. Engaging with films will offer students an additional cultural context to examine critically the development of nation and national ideologies such as “the myth of racial democracy”. It also aims at contributing to students’ development of the idea of a multicultural and socially multi-diverse Brazil, with specific social, economic, and cultural realities in different geographical areas as shown in assigned films.
1 credit.
Eligible for FMST
Fall 2025. Almeida.
